MTR. OF MACK v. COURT OF GEN. SESSIONS


14 A.D.2d 98 (1961)

In the Matter of Nathaniel Mack, Petitioner, v. Court of General Sessions of the County of New York et al., Respondents

Appellate Division of the Supreme Court of the State of New York, First Department.

July 6, 1961.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

Arthur Addess of counsel (Bobick & Deutsch, attorneys), for petitioner.

Melvin Stein of counsel (H. Richard Uviller with him on the brief; Frank S. Hogan, District Attorney), for respondents.

BREITEL and McNALLY, JJ., concur with STEVENS, J.; BOTEIN, P. J., dissents and votes to deny the application, in opinion in which STEUER, J., concurs.


STEVENS, J.

Petitioner was indicted by the Grand Jury of Queens County in May, 1960, on two counts.
